If you want the best flashcart and don't care about the price: CycloDS Evolution
If you want the best flashcart but do care about the price: Acekard 2
If you want a flashcart with onboard NAND memory: Acekard R.P.G.
If you want a flashcart that also offers a Slot-2 (not for free though): EZFlash V & M3DS Real
If you want a Slot-2 expansion: EZFlash 3-in-1 (GBA, RAM, & Rumble)
If you want a flashcart that could possible brick your Nintendo DS: R4 DS, R4 III & N5

PharaohsVizier said:
Where's the Supercard?!
He apparently doesn't know anything/not much at all about Scds1, so he just decided to leave it out. Makes those recommendations kinda biased when you think about it.

Scds1 offers many features/functions comparable to that of CycloDS Evo and is available at a much lower price. Supercard Team has also proven to provide very good support for all their flashcarts since they still update their earliest product. The GUI might not be top-notch and is a little sluggish, but I don't think that people who have a flashcart sit and watches it's GUI when they could be playing roms. You'll also have the chance to use three different OSs (the official Scds1 OS, DSTT OS and Ysmenu).
